What can you conclude about the total mechanical energy of a pendulum as it swings back and forth?
Alchen [17]

Answer:

The total mechanical energy of a pendulum is conserved neglecting the friction.

Explanation:

  • When a simple pendulum swings back and forth, it has some energy associated with its motion.
  • The total energy of a simple pendulum in harmonic motion at any instant of time is equal to the sum of the potential and kinetic energy.
  • The potential energy of the simple pendulum is given by P.E = mgh
  • The kinetic energy of the simple pendulum is given by, K.E = 1/2mv²
  • When the pendulum swings to one end, its velocity equals zero temporarily where the potential energy becomes maximum.
  • When the pendulum reaches the vertical line, its velocity and kinetic energy become maximum.
  • Hence, the total mechanical energy of a pendulum as it swings back and forth is conserved neglecting the resistance.

An apple falls straight down from a tree and hits the ground in approximately 0.75 seconds. Based on this information, which is
Mnenie [13.5K]

Answer:

y = 2.76 [m]

Explanation:

We can find the distance of the fall of the apple using the following kinematic equation, we have to emphasize that this is a typical problem of free fall, so the initial speed is zero, then we give the initial data.

t = time = 0,75[s]

g = gravity = 9.81[m/s^2]

v0 = 0

y = v_{0}*t+0.5*g*t^{2}\\ y=0.5*(9.81)*(0.75)^{2}\\y= 2.76[m]
